Title:
HYDROGEN PEROXIDE RESISTANCE-IMPARTING GENE AND METHOD FOR USING SAME

Abstract:
Provided is a gene that is useful for imparting hydrogen peroxide resistance to a microorganism. Also provided is a method for using the same. The hydrogen peroxide resistance-imparting gene encodes a protein selected from the following (a) through (c): (a) a protein formed from an amino acid sequence represented by Sequence No. 2, (b) a protein having hydrogen peroxide resistance-imparting capability formed from an amino acid sequence wherein one or more amino acids have been deleted, substituted or added in the amino acid sequence of (a), and (c) a protein having hydrogen peroxide resistance-imparting capability formed from an amino acid sequence that has 85% or greater identity with the amino acid sequence of (a).
